Dear Trade (TRADE),

Under the right of access to documents in the EU treaties, as developed in Regulation 1049/2001, I am requesting documents which contain the following information:

- minutes and other reports of the meetings of the market access working groups (MAWG) on automotives, chemicals, distribution services, medical devices, textiles, postal services and SPS in 2012 and 2013

- minutes and other reports of the meetings of the market access advisory committee (MAAC) which took place between February 2012 and today

Dear Pia,

I would like to update you on the state of play of your request.

The first batch containing MAAC reports has been put in circulation for approval of our hierarchy, and normally should reach you still this year or very early next year. We are still working on the second part related MAWG and hope to be able to send it to you February or March next year.

The delay is caused because we are assessing a widest possible access for you and as these reports treat some sensitive questions related to market access problems with third countries we need to screen these reports cautiously in order to comply with Article 4.1(a) 3' of the regulation – " The institutions shall refuse access to a document where disclosure would undermine the protection of international relations".
